JACKSONVILLE, Fla. - June 28, 2013 - PRLog -- A Quick Look to an Insane Mind is E. N. De Choudens’s first full-length published work. This book is the dark and disturbing musing of a serial killer, confined to a mental institution for the criminally insane, brought to life in the haunting words of the author. Like the tales of H. P. Lovecraft or those of Edgar Allen Poe, De Choudens’s work of fictional horror reaches into the terrifying recesses of the mind of a man for his crimes. This work of poetry and prose, released though Leo Publishing, LLC, is a chilling look at the thought process from the point of view of that disturbed individual.
